Could Castletown ban plastic bags? That was one suggestion made during the last commissioners meeting.
The board considered a letter from the southern branch of the green group Transition Isle of Man which asked them to consider eliminating the bags from local shops.
Although the commissioners agreed, they said it would be impractical and difficult to force on local traders, given paper bags were expensive.
Castletown Commissioners chairman Alwyn Collister says it’s a move that has worked elsewhere.
